Description:
Small native evergreen shrub with soft green needle-like foliage and large red/yellow bottlebrush-like flowers from Autumn through to Winter. Great to use as an informal hedge. Drought tolerant and suitable to coastal gardens. Grows approx. 1.5mm tall x 1.5m wide.
